As a result, the remaining portion of Gumbas Bridge was also swept away by the floodwaters.
Flood debris was scattered across the road, forcing the Chitral-Peshawar Road to be closed to traffic.
The flash flood also blocked roads in Baroz Gol and Sheedi village, disrupting road connectivity and cutting off traffic in the affected areas.
The scale of the destruction spans the vast geography of the district, stretching from Sheshi Koh Valley and Drosh town in Lower Chitral district all the way to Mastuj in Upper Chitral district.
